How much do business process analyst j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 27, 2026, the average yearly pay for business process analyst in Iowa is $73,842.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$57,300.00 and $77,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

How does a Business Process Analyst typically collaborate with cross-functional teams to implement process improvements?

Business Process Analysts regularly work with various departments—such as IT, operations, finance, and HR—to gather insights, map current processes, and identify areas for improvement. They facilitate workshops, conduct interviews, and lead meetings to ensure all stakeholder perspectives are considered. Once solutions are identified, Business Process Analysts coordinate with these teams to pilot changes, monitor outcomes, and refine processes based on feedback. This collaborative approach ensures that improvements are practical, widely supported, and sustainable across the organization.

What Is a Business Process Analyst?

As a business process analyst, you examine a company’s operations and processes to find areas for improvement. You may work as part of an external management consulting firm or be hired directly by the company or organization. Your job duties include reviewing business administration procedures, interviewing employees for performance data, and creating reports based on your analysis.

What does a Business Process Analyst do?

A Business Process Analyst evaluates and improves organizational processes to enhance efficiency and effectiveness. They work closely with various departments to identify bottlenecks, gather requirements, and develop solutions that streamline workflows. Their responsibilities often include analyzing current business processes, documenting findings, recommending improvements, and sometimes helping implement new systems or procedures. The goal is to help the organization operate more smoothly and cost-effectively.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Business Process Analyst,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Business Process Analyst, you need strong analytical skills, process mapping expertise, and a background in business or related fields, often supported by a bachelor’s degree. Familiarity with process modeling tools such as Visio or Bizagi, as well as certifications like Lean Six Sigma, are commonly required. Excellent communication, problem-solving, and stakeholder management skills help analysts facilitate change and drive process improvements. These abilities are crucial for identifying inefficiencies, optimizing workflows, and ensuring successful project outcomes.

What is the difference between Business Process Analyst vs Business Systems Analyst?

AspectBusiness Process AnalystBusiness Systems Analyst
Required CredentialsBachelor's in Business, Management, or related field; certifications like CBAP or Six SigmaBachelor's in IT, Computer Science, or related; certifications like CBAP or CBSA
Work EnvironmentCorporate offices, consulting firms, or project-based settingsIT departments, software companies, or consulting firms
Employer & Industry UsageFinance, healthcare, manufacturing, and other industries focusing on process improvementTechnology, software development, and organizations implementing new systems

While both roles involve analyzing and improving organizational functions, Business Process Analysts focus on optimizing workflows and processes, whereas Business Systems Analysts concentrate on implementing and supporting IT systems to meet business needs.
